Diesel is a 2 year old neutered male Presa Canario that I pulled to foster
from the Manhattan SPCA this weekend. He is a social boy that will bond
quickly and strongly to a new owner. He is fine with female dogs and
submissive male dogs (he is a dominant, but not aggressive, recently
neutered male). He was an owner surrender (landlord wouldn't let them keep
him), who showed no food or toy possession at the shelter. He grew up with
multiple kids, down to the age of four. He has no history of aggression.
He is microchipped and up to date with all of his vaccines. He was
reported to be housebroken, but has marked in the house (needs a tune-
up:)). He is very responsive to correction and should be easy to train.

You can note a funky stance in the hind end in a couple of the pics. I had him looked at by an Orthopedics specialist at Cornell Vet today and he noted an old tibial break in the right leg. It is well healed at this point and not causing him any problems. In the long run he may have some arthritis in that leg, but should have no other issues related to the break. He is strong as an ox and it sure isn't slowing him down any.

He was very good at the vet school today. We met many people and other dogs and at no point did he show any signs of aggression. He will bark at strangers that approach the car when he is in it. He travels well and is calm and quiet in the house. He is current on all vaccinations and is heartworm negative.

As a side note, I think with a young male in the house you are going to be much better off adopting a female dog as a companion. This breed is notorious for same- sex aggression. I just posted a female in a Baltimore shelter that you are welcome to check out.
